Ulcerative Colitis (UC) is a chronic inflammatory bowel disease that causes inflammation and ulcers in the lining of the colon, leading to symptoms like abdominal pain, diarrhea, and rectal bleeding.
We are studying if specific markers can help identify patients who can safely stop their anti-TNF treatment while in remission. This may help tailor treatment plans for better health outcomes.

Crohn's Disease is a type of inflammatory bowel disease that can affect any part of the gastrointestinal tract, causing symptoms such as abdominal pain, severe diarrhea, fatigue, and weight loss.
